body {margin:0;padding:0;width: 3850px;height: 519px;color:#900; font: 62.5%/150% Tahoma, Sans-Serif; background: #cccc66; /*url(../img/bground_fons.png) repeat-x left top;*/}
#googleMaps{position: absolute;top: 50%;margin-top:-225px;left: 50%;margin-left:-390px;width:780px;height: 450px;}
#mapsFooter{ text-align:center; height:25px; width:780px;; background-color:#7C1D20; color: #FFFFFF; line-height:25px;}
#mapsFooter a{ color:#FFFFFF;}
h2 {font-size: 1.1em; color:#999;}
h3 {font-size: 1.4em; color:#000;}

a, a:link, a:visited { text-decoration:none; color:#900;}
a:hover{ text-decoration:underline;}

hr, .hide {position:absolute; top:0; left:-9000px;}	

/* posar un fons a tota la pàgina primer un fons per tota la pàgina..............*/
#backG {background-image:url(../img/fons_background.gif); background-repeat: repeat-x; height: 550px; }

/*afegeixo div per la foto del inici*/
#imgInici{float:left; padding-top:50px; text-align:center; width:550px;}

/* i aquí sols el fons del inici de la pàgina.....................................*/
#page { background-image:url(../img/fons_layer.jpg); background-repeat: no-repeat; height: 550px; }

#leftsider { float: left; width:300px; height:350px; padding-top: 5px; padding-right: 0; padding-bottom: 0; padding-left: 50px;}

#leftsider h1 {font-size: 2.5em; color:#CC6;}

/*menú modificat..............................................................................*/
#menu { padding-left:60px; height:30px; font-family:Arial, Helvetica, sans-serif; font-size:12px; width: 550px;}
#menu ul { float:left; margin:0; padding:0; list-style:none; width: 530px; }
#menu ul li { float:left;}
#menu a{ display:block; padding:0 10px; line-height:20px; text-decoration:none; color: #900;}
#menu a:hover{ border-bottom:1px dashed #fff;}


#content { margin: 90px 0 0 40px;  float: left; font-size: 1.1em; }
#content h4 {font-size: 1.2em;}

/* SECCIONS ....................................*/
/* modifico secció per secció ....................................*/
.par_uno { margin: 30px 30px 0 0px; padding-left: 30px; float: left; width: 560px; height: 400px;}
.par { margin: 30px 30px 0 0px; padding-left: 30px; float: left; width: 315px; height: 400px; background-image:url(../img/fons_cuina.jpg); background-repeat:no-repeat; background-position:center;}
.par_seventh { margin: 30px 30px 0 0px; padding-left: 30px; float: left; width: 315px; height: 400px; background-image:url(../img/fons_mapa.jpg); background-repeat: no-repeat; background-position:center;}
.par_eight { margin: 30px 30px 0 0px; padding-left: 30px; float: left; width: 315px; height: 400px; background-image:url(../img/fons_contacte.gif); background-repeat: no-repeat; background-position:center;}
.par_nine { margin: 30px 30px 0 0px; padding-left: 30px; float: left; width: 315px; height: 400px; background-image:url(../img/fons_links.gif); background-repeat: no-repeat; background-position:center;}
.par_cuatro { margin: 30px 30px 0 0px; padding-left: 30px; float: left; width: 680px; height: 400px;}
.par_seis { margin: 30px 30px 0 0px; padding-left: 30px; float: left; width: 315px; height: 400px; /*background-image:url(../img/fons_par_dos.gif);  background-repeat: no-repeat; background-position:left;*/}

.galeria {float: left; width: 680px; background-color:#660000; padding-top:10px;  height: 30px; text-align:center;}
.texto, .button {font-size:10px; font-family:Verdana, Arial, Helvetica, sans-serif;}
.alt {/* modify this to add style to alternate sections*/}

#note { margin-top:10px; }

p.secbot a{
	margin-top: -5px;
	padding-left: 15px;
	border-bottom:none;
	color: #22b1e1;
	background: url(../img/leftsmall.png) no-repeat scroll left center;
	text-decoration:none;
	font-size:0.9em;
}

p.secbot a:hover { border-bottom:1px solid #22b1e1; }

#arrows { position: fixed; top: 440px; left: 650px; width: 90px; height: 30px; cursor: pointer; }

#arrows ul { margin: 0; padding: 0; list-style:none; }

#arrows ul li {margin: 0; padding: 0; display:inline; width: 40px; height: 30px; }

#arrows ul li a{
	margin-right: 5px;
	float: left;
	display: block;
	width: 40px;
	height: 30px;
	overflow: hidden;
	cursor: pointer;
	font-size: 50em;
	text-indent: -9000px;
}

#arrows ul #left a {background: transparent url(../img/leftbig.png) no-repeat;}
#arrows ul #right a{background: transparent  url(../img/rightbig.png) no-repeat;}


#rightsider {
	padding: 0 10px 0px 0;
}	

#rightsider a{
	color: #22b1e1;
	text-decoration: none;
}

#subscribe { /* background image block */
display: block;
width: 215px;
height: 60px;
background: url(images/options.png) no-repeat;
margin-top: 0px;
}
/*#subscribe a {
text-decoration:none;
}*/

.hide {
visibility:hidden;
}

#situacio {float: left; position:absolute; width : 180px; height: 23px;left: 2600px; top: 475px;}

